#714daf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#714daf is composed of 44.3% red, 30.2% green and 68.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.4% cyan, 56% magenta, 0%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 262 degrees, a saturation of 38.9% and a lightness of 49.4%. #714daf color hex could be obtained by blending #e29aff with #00005f.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

● #714daf color description : Dark moderate violet.
#714daf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#714daf has RGB values of R:113, G:77, B:175 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0.56, Y:0,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 7425455.

Shades and Tints of #714daf
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07050c is the darkest color, while #fdf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#714daf
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e7d7f is the less saturated color, while #5f09f3 is the most saturated one.
